Extending Enameled Cookware Durability
To ensure your nonstick cookware stays beautiful and functional for years to come, regular maintenance is quite essential. Avoid using rough scouring pads or steel utensils, as these can quickly damage the delicate coating. Instead, opt for soft sponges and plastic tools. After each session, carefully wash your pans with mild detergent, and frequently allow them to cool completely before setting them in the dishwasher – although hand-washing is generally recommended for optimal results. Besides, avoid extreme temperature changes, like immersing a hot pan into cold water, which can cause cracking. Selecting Resilient Ceramic Pots & Pans: A Consumer's Manual
Ceramic cookware has swiftly achieved popularity, and for good reason – it offers a unique combination of non-stick properties, attractive aesthetics, and relative affordability. But with so many options available, identifying the appropriate set can feel overwhelming. This guide will assist you explore the world of durable ceramic cookware, covering key aspects to consider. Begin by understanding the differences in ceramic coating depth – a thicker coating generally contributes to improved durability and longevity. Also, give close heed to the base material; a heavy, multi-ply base ensures even heat distribution, stopping hot spots and inconsistent cooking. Finally, always check manufacturer feedback to gauge the actual performance and sustained reliability of the pots & pans set you're evaluating.
